LAURENCE SIMPSON, Warden’and R.M. APPLICATION FOR LEASE. Alexandra: —Dunstan. June 2nd, 1879. To tho[ Warden at Alexandra. WE hereby apply for a GoldMining Lease of the lands hereinafter described, in accordance with the Gold-Mining Leases Regulations of New Zealand, and we agree upon the approval of; this application, to execute '.a Lease upon the basis therein stated, if the Governor shall think fit to[grant[the"sarae. JOHN BENNETT, Applicant. Name and address in full of Applicants : —John Bennett, George Cameron, John Dewar Frederick Keppler, William Hansen, and William Beattie, Alexandra, County of Vincent Stylo under which it is intended to conduct the business;— Bennett and Company. Extent of Land applied for Sixteen acres—4oo yards by 200 yards. Minimum No. of'men’to be employed by the Lessees : —For the first 12 months, 1 ] two men. Subsequently when in lull work (i men. Amount of Capital proposed to bo invested :—£l2oo. Proposed mode of working the Laudj:—Tunnelling and crushing. Precise Locality ;—Conroy’s reef, West side of Conroy’s Gully. Term for required ; 15 years. Time’of commencing operations ; Immediately. General Remarks;— None. The above application and any objection thereto will be heard at the Warden’s Office at Alexandra, on the 28th July, 1879. Any person desiring to object to the issue of a Mining Lease upon the above application must, within 54 clear days from the date of such application, at the Warden’s Office at Alexandra. W.
